About Orcutt Junior High

Orcutt Junior High is a public middle school in Orcutt, CA, part of Orcutt Union Elementary. Orcutt Junior High serves approximately 480 students, and covers grades 7th-8th, and has a 22.9:1 student-teacher ratio. Orcutt Junior High has a current MySchoolScout rating of 5.2 out of 10 and ranks #6,971 of 9,539 schools in CA.

Structured state assessment records for Orcutt Junior High show 49%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2024) and 56%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2024).

What Parents Should Know

Orcutt Junior High runs 22.9:1 students to teachers, above the national average. That often means bigger classes. Ask how the school supports kids who need extra help, and whether there are teaching assistants or small-group time.

Nearby Alternatives

Families considering Orcutt Junior High may also want to explore other middle schools in the area. Lakeview Junior High (rated 5.9/10, 2.0 miles away), which scores slightly higher. Additionally, Arellanes Junior High (rated 5.8/10, 3.3 miles away, in nearby Santa Maria), which scores slightly higher. For more schools in Orcutt, see our Orcutt schools guide .
